Expect problems with insulin pumps
22nd May 2014
Problems with insulin pumps are common and users should have action plans in place to help them avoid hospitalisation, diabetes experts from NSW have shown.

A review of more than 400 children using Medtronic insulin pumps found that one in ten had an adverse event over a four-month period, with a third of these children requiring hospitalisation due to the pump problems.
